Milwaukee M18 2601-22 Information
The Milwaukee M18 2601-22 is a compact, cordless drill/driver that is powered by an 18-volt lithium-ion battery. It features a 4-pole brushless motor that delivers 425 inch-pounds of peak torque, making it a powerful tool for a variety of applications.
The drill/driver has a two-speed gearbox that provides 0-350 RPM and 0-1,400 RPM, giving you the flexibility to choose the right speed for the task at hand. It also has a built-in LED light that illuminates your work surface, making it easier to see what you're doing in low-light conditions.
The drill/driver is lightweight and well-balanced, making it comfortable to use for extended periods of time. It also has a durable construction that can withstand the rigors of everyday use.

Milwaukee M18 2601-22 Problems and Solutions
The Milwaukee M18 2601-22 is a powerful cordless drill, but it can sometimes experience problems. Here are some of the most common issues and solutions:
Problem: The battery may not charge properly.
Solution:
- Make sure the battery is inserted correctly into the charger.
- Clean the battery contacts with a soft cloth.
- If the battery is still not charging, contact Milwaukee customer support for assistance.
Problem: The tool may not start.
Solution:
- Make sure the battery is inserted correctly into the tool.
- Clean the battery contacts with a soft cloth.
- Check the trigger switch to make sure it is not stuck.
- If the tool still does not start, contact Milwaukee customer support for assistance.
Problem: The tool may overheat.
Solution:
- Allow the tool to cool down before using it again.
- Make sure the tool is not being used in a dusty or dirty environment.
- If the tool continues to overheat, contact Milwaukee customer support for assistance.
